Gallowhill Caravan and Camping Park
From £24 For 1 night, 6 adults- Peaceful family-run park in a handy location on the edge of Kinross
- Loch Leven 10 minutes’ drive, and Perth city centre 20 minutes
- Play park and communal bothy on site, plus a woodland dog-walking area

- When can I check in and check out of Gallowhill Caravan and Camping Park?
RV, travel trailer and tent sites Arrive: 11 a.m. – 9 p.m. Depart by: 2 p.m. If running late because of traffic please call ahead to let the office know.
